...
比特币钱包是存储比特币的数字工具,用户可以通过它发送、接收和管理比特币。钱包的功能不仅仅限于存储其私钥和公钥,还涉及与区块链网络的交互。它们可以是软件应用、硬件设备,甚至是纸质钱包。无论是哪种形式,所有比特币钱包的核心功能都是保证用户资产的安全性和提供便利的交易经验。
比特币钱包的算法主要涉及到加密算法与签名算法,这两者是保护用户资金和交易安全的基础。首先,比特币利用了椭圆曲线数字签名算法(ECDSA)来生成公钥和私钥。私钥是一个随机生成的256位数字,用户必须妥善保管,以确保控制资金和进行交易。同时,公钥则由私钥通过特定的数学转换生成,能够被广泛地分享用于接收比特币。
其次,为了提高交易的安全性,每当用户发起交易,钱包软件会通过私钥对交易进行签名。这一签名过程确保了交易的不可伪造性,仅有持有对应私钥的人才能生成有效的交易签名。这也为比特币网络中的每一笔交易提供了有效的身份验证。在这一过程中,SHA-256哈希算法也起到了重要作用,确保交易数据的一致性和安全性。
尽管比特币钱包的设计在理论上拥有很高的安全性,现实中却面临着不少挑战。例如,用户的私钥如果被黑客获取,资金就会被毫无例外地转移。防止此类攻击的关键在于提升用户的安全意识并采用更安全的存储方式,例如使用硬件钱包或多重签名钱包。此外,用户还应定期更新软件,以防止因漏洞造成的安全隐患。
在设计比特币钱包时,除了安全性,用户体验同样至关重要。一个优秀的钱包应该具备简单易用的界面,能够方便用户完成资金的存取。此外,钱包的性能稳定性和响应速度也是用户选择钱包的重要因素。许多钱包应用还集成了实时价格监控、交易历史记录等有用的功能,为用户提供更为便捷的管理体验。
随着区块链技术的不断演进,比特币钱包也在不断创新与发展。去中心化钱包的出现使得用户可以完全控制自己的私钥,提升了安全性。同时,隐私保护技术也在不断进步,例如环签名和零知识证明等,使得用户的交易更加私密。此外,跨链交易与闪电网络的引入,将进一步提升比特币钱包的使用场景和灵活性。
比特币钱包与传统的银行钱包或实体钱包有着显著的区别。首先,传统钱包通常是用来存储纸币和硬币的物理空间,而比特币钱包则是数字化的信息存储工具。其次,在安全性方面,传统钱包可以通过银行系统的集成保护个人资产,而比特币钱包的安全性完全依赖于用户的私钥管理。用户应该了解这两者的差异,以便更好地管理各自的资产。
选择一个安全的比特币钱包需要考虑多个因素,首先是在信誉和用户评价上,选择知名度高且受信任的品牌。其次,钱包的安全特性如双因素身份验证、冷存储选择和开源代码等,都是重要的选择标准。此外,用户的个人需求也会影响选择,例如是否频繁交易、对用户界面的偏好等,都需要综合考虑。
虽然比特币钱包系统采取了一系列安全措施,但黑客仍然可能借助各种攻击手段来窃取用户的资产。在许多情况下,攻击并非直接针对网络,而是通过钓鱼攻击、恶意软件或弱密码等简单手段获取用户的私钥。因此,提高用户安全意识、采取复杂强密码以及定期更新软件,是帮助防范这些攻击的重要策略。
某些比特币钱包支持多种加密货币的存储与交易。这些钱包通常被称为多币种钱包,能够同时处理多种数字资产,提升了用户管理资产的便利性。然而,用户在选择这类钱包时,需要确保该钱包的安全性和兼容性,以避免因不兼容导致的资产损失或交易失败。
备份比特币钱包是确保用户资产安全的重要步骤。用户应定期备份私钥和钱包文件,最好将备份存储在离线设备中,减少在线泄露的风险。许多钱包软件还提供了一键备份的功能,用户应定期使用。这种备份方法能有效防止因设备故障或丢失导致用户资产无法恢复。
通过此文的详细介绍,用户能够更全面地了解到比特币钱包的算法、安全设计、市场挑战以及未来发展趋势。同时,针对一些常见的问题的深入解答,将帮助用户在使用比特币钱包时,更加安全且便捷。希望本文能够为有兴趣的用户提供有价值的信息与帮助。